Output 3d573d0604242693a6b98fd4f40420cf4b0f60682e5a37196b07ccd2bfbc4a9a:2

value
844200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b18fede12f94b7f2e8f1555f0e7937ab42e355 OP_EQUAL
address
3QdrEw45E76q4hUda4foQXomsYqXfm6J3Q
transaction
3d573d0604242693a6b98fd4f40420cf4b0f60682e5a37196b07ccd2bfbc4a9a
confirmations
327510
spent
true